Become The Best You've Ever Been

Let’s face it. You and me, like every other person on this planet get into slumps or experience bumps in life's road and at times, need a boost. It’s easy provided you acknowledge the fact that it’s up to you and me to bring the feel-good-factor to pep up our lives. Nobody else will do it for us. Even on a bad day, I keep hoping that things will get better and if they don’t, on their own, I intervene.

I’ll tell you some rituals that I perform and stay away from the not-so-good-feelings that bog down many of us in a similar fashion. You too can try these and stay motivated.

1.Stick to your normal healthy routine: Eat a good breakfast. If you didn’t, have a healthy lunch. Pick one fruit of your choice and munch it on your way back home. Exercise for about 30 minutes every day depending on when you find the time; morning or evening.

2. Listen to something inspirational and/or healing (my favorite): Load your iPod with a play list for your choice. Enjoy your favorite music while cooking, stair climbing, or doing routine household chores. One of my favorite ways to start the day is by cranking some tunes and dancing while brushing my teeth.

3. Smile is contagious and it costs nothing: Make a deliberate effort to smile at people. They will smile back and you’ll feel good too. Observe things that make you smile and keep them in the corner of your head. They’ll make you smile when you sit in contemplation.

4. Feel good about yourself; always and all ways: Do you believe in Law of Attraction? It says that you attract into your life whatever you think about. So the idea is to feel and hope for everything good. If you stay motivated and positive by thinking about good things, you’ll get them.

5. Hang around with cheerful people: Friends or colleagues who belittle you in the disguise of “joking around,” make you feel terrible. Avoid them. Make friends with those whose positive energy makes you feel good. Go for a movie or have coffee with someone who cares for you treats you with love and respect.

6. You are inimitable: Don’t get into the petty habit of comparing yourself with others. When I do that, I feel bad and feel like a failure. Instead, I’ve started believing that I’m exactly where I’m supposed to be and that I’ll get where I want to, at the right time, under the right circumstances, and with the right people. This is what keeps me going.

7. Look good to feel good: This is probably the least talked about but awfully effective. Invest in nice, bright colored clothes. Dress in cheerful dresses and pretty shoes. And wear a stunning smile. It’ll get you noticed (in a good way of course!). People will like to speak to you. They’ll listen to what you have to say. When you step into a room, you won’t have to say or do anything to get people’s attention. Your positive vibes will do that for you.
